Frequently Asked Questions About This Acquisition

When did IBM acquire Collation, Inc.?

IBM acquired Collation, Inc. on November 15, 2005. This was IBM's 40th publicly tracked acquisition out of 170 we have on record.

How much did IBM pay for Collation, Inc.?

The price IBM paid for Collation, Inc. was not publicly disclosed. Only 37 of IBM's 170 tracked acquisitions have a disclosed price.
